The digits of some specific integers permute or shift cyclically when they are multiplied by a number n. Examples are: * 142857 × 3 = 428571 (shifts cyclically one place left) * 142857 × 5 = 714285 (shifts cyclically one place right) * 128205 × 4 = 512820 (shifts cyclically one place right) * 076923 × 9 = 692307 (shifts cyclically two places left) These specific integers, known as transposable integers, can be but are not always cyclic numbers. The characterization of such numbers can be done using repeating decimals (and thus the related fractions), or directly.
